[ aws . codecommit ]
Sets aside (overrides) all approval rule requirements for a specified pull request.

--pull-request-id (string)
The system-generated ID of the pull request for which you want to override all approval rule requirements. To get this information, use GetPullRequest .
--revision-id (string)
The system-generated ID of the most recent revision of the pull request. You cannot override approval rules for anything but the most recent revision of a pull request. To get the revision ID, use GetPullRequest.
--override-status (string)
Whether you want to set aside approval rule requirements for the pull request (OVERRIDE) or revoke a previous override and apply approval rule requirements (REVOKE). REVOKE status is not stored.
Possible values:
OVERRIDE
REVOKE
--cli-input-json | --cli-input-yaml (string)
Reads arguments from the JSON string provided. The JSON string follows the format provided by --generate-cli-skeleton. If other arguments are provided on the command line, those values will override the JSON-provided values. It is not possible to pass arbitrary binary values using a JSON-provided value as the string will be taken literally. This may not be specified along with --cli-input-yaml.
--generate-cli-skeleton (string)
Prints a JSON skeleton to standard output without sending an API request. If provided with no value or the value input, prints a sample input JSON that can be used as an argument for --cli-input-json. Similarly, if provided yaml-input it will print a sample input YAML that can be used with --cli-input-yaml. If provided with the value output, it validates the command inputs and returns a sample output JSON for that command.

To override approval rule requirements on a pull request
The following override-pull-request-approval-rules example overrides approval rules on the specified pull request. To revoke an override instead, set the --override-status parameter value to REVOKE.
aws codecommit override-pull-request-approval-rules \
--pull-request-id 34 \
--revision-id 927df8d8EXAMPLE \
--override-status OVERRIDE
This command produces no output.
